Some inductors have a dot on their bodies to indicate polarity. That's how I mark it in my footprints. I do this using the Drawing Elements - Symbol/Shapes tool (icon). If this were to be automated, it would also be helpful to have control over the dot's position.

Adding Pin 1 Post Assembly Inspection Dots on Silkscreen is automatic.
Turn this feature on in Options > Drafting > Silkscreen. |
